R
Robert SiersemaReview ofNasa-ne
I have been using Nasa-ne for a while now and I ha...
I have been using Nasa-ne for a while now and I have to say their service is excellent. The website is user-friendly and the navigation is smooth. The company provides accurate and up-to-date information, and their customer support is top-notch. I highly recommend using Nasa-ne for all your needs!

Comments: